Medical Role of the Scalpel

In the world of medicine, the scalpel is a critical tool. Surgeons rely on it to perform operations on skin, tissue, and internal organs. The scalpel knife allows them to make clean and precise incisions. This helps to reduce damage to nearby areas and promotes faster healing. Without the scalpel, many surgeries would not be possible. It is also used in emergency care and outpatient procedures, showing its wide medical value.

Cosmetic and Beauty Treatments

Cosmetic procedures often involve reshaping parts of the body or skin. In these treatments, the scalpel is used for its precision. Skin specialists use the scalpel knife in treatments like dermaplaning to remove dead skin and fine hairs. This improves the skin’s texture and glow. In plastic surgery, scalpels are used to adjust features with great care. A skilled hand and a sharp blade can help clients feel more confident.

Safety and Skill in Scalpel Use

Handling a scalpel requires training and focus. Whether in surgery or art, a wrong move can cause injury or damage. That’s why professionals learn to use the scalpel knife with care. They also follow safety steps like using gloves, cleaning blades, and storing tools properly. Dull or damaged blades are replaced quickly to ensure the best results. Good habits around scalpel use keep users and others safe.
